Fatality · MSHA Record #219892480001
Roof Bolter
August 28, 1989
at 8:15 PM
Operator:
Clinchfield Coal Company
(Pittston Company)
Dickenson County, VA
Classification
MACHINERY
Type
Caught in, under or between a moving and a stationary object
Investigator narrative
THE VICTIM WAS IN THE PROCESS OF DRILLING A ROOF BOLT HOLE WHEN HIS HEAD WAS CAUGHT BETWEEN THE STATIONARY CANOPY AND THE MOVING DRILL HEAD BOOM OF THE BOTLING MACHINE. THE VICTIM SUSTAINED FA TAL MULTIPLE-TRAUMA HEAD INJURIES.
